Description
For sample adults who had participated in skating in the past 2 weeks (EXSKATE), EXSKATEMIN reports the average number of minutes respondents had spent doing skating each time they had engaged in that activity over the past 2 weeks.
After determining that a respondent participated in skating, respondents were first asked, "How many times in the past 2 weeks did you go skating?" (EXSKATENO). They were then asked, "On the average, about how many minutes did you spend skating each time?" EXSKATEMIN reports the answer to this last question.
Related Variables
As a follow-up, respondents were asked how much their heart rate or breathing had increased while skating (EXSKATEBR).
EXSKATEMIN is used as one of the input variables in the IHIS-created variable EXSUM1, which is a summary variable that reports whether a respondent would have met the exercise recommendations set forth in the 2008 Physical Activity Guidelines for Americans.
Universe
- 1985; 1990: Sample persons aged 18-64 who skated in the past 2 weeks.
Codes
This is a 3-digit numeric variable.
Availability
- 1985, 1990
